Output 93b897a4ea94ef64cee9419d2a1de5b1ef895ebfd259e52dc03b89edf369a589:5

value
732634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c3b16d166a6ee66c8b383b0f5fa43d72c8b795 OP_EQUAL
address
37EJu3ei8gH1Z8XMP6phPmoQVS2FSkvbKA
transaction
93b897a4ea94ef64cee9419d2a1de5b1ef895ebfd259e52dc03b89edf369a589
spent
true